Just as with a taken care of annuity, the proprietor of a variable annuity pays an insurance provider a round figure or series of repayments for the guarantee of a series of future payments in return. However as pointed out over, while a repaired annuity grows at an ensured, constant price, a variable annuity expands at a variable rate that depends upon the performance of the underlying investments, called sub-accounts.
During the accumulation phase, possessions invested in variable annuity sub-accounts grow on a tax-deferred basis and are exhausted just when the contract proprietor withdraws those profits from the account. After the build-up stage comes the income stage. With time, variable annuity assets must in theory increase in worth up until the contract owner decides she or he wish to start taking out money from the account.
The most considerable concern that variable annuities generally present is high price. Variable annuities have several layers of fees and expenditures that can, in aggregate, create a drag of up to 3-4% of the contract's worth each year.

Variable annuities tend to be highly ineffective lorries for passing riches to the following generation since they do not enjoy a cost-basis modification when the initial contract proprietor passes away. When the proprietor of a taxable investment account passes away, the price bases of the investments held in the account are gotten used to mirror the marketplace prices of those financial investments at the time of the owner's fatality.
Such is not the situation with variable annuities. Investments held within a variable annuity do not obtain a cost-basis modification when the original owner of the annuity dies.
One substantial concern associated with variable annuities is the capacity for problems of passion that might feed on the part of annuity salespeople. Unlike an economic advisor, who has a fiduciary obligation to make financial investment decisions that benefit the customer, an insurance policy broker has no such fiduciary responsibility. Annuity sales are highly profitable for the insurance experts who offer them due to high ahead of time sales commissions.
Several variable annuity contracts include language which positions a cap on the percentage of gain that can be experienced by specific sub-accounts. These caps avoid the annuity proprietor from totally joining a section of gains that might or else be appreciated in years in which markets generate substantial returns. From an outsider's perspective, presumably that financiers are trading a cap on investment returns for the previously mentioned guaranteed flooring on financial investment returns.
As noted over, give up charges can seriously limit an annuity proprietor's capability to relocate properties out of an annuity in the early years of the agreement. Further, while a lot of variable annuities permit agreement owners to withdraw a defined quantity during the accumulation phase, withdrawals beyond this quantity generally result in a company-imposed cost.
Withdrawals made from a fixed passion price financial investment alternative can additionally experience a "market price adjustment" or MVA. An MVA changes the value of the withdrawal to show any type of adjustments in rate of interest from the moment that the money was bought the fixed-rate alternative to the moment that it was taken out.
